On Tue, Jun 16, 2009 at 1:03 PM, Robert Haas<robertmhaas@gmail.com> wrote: > I see that... but I don't think the test in the first loop is correct. > It's based on the value of i % 4, but I'm not convinced that you know > anything about the alignment at the point where i == 0. That's correct. To check the alignment you would have to look at the actual pointer. I would suggest using the existing macros to handle alignment. Hm, though the only one I see offhand which is relevant is the moderately silly PointerIsAligned(). Still it would make the code clearer even if it's pretty simple. Incidentally, the char foo[4] = {' ',' ',' ',' '} suggestion is, I think, bogus. There would be no alignment guarantee on that array. Personally I'm find with 0x20202020 with a comment explaining what it is. -- greg http://mit.edu/~gsstark/resume.pdf
